๐Ÿ“ Flooring Calculation Geometry & Square Footage Formulas

Core Flooring Equation:
Gross Sq Ft = [ (Length ร— Width) + Extra Area ] ร— (1 + Waste Factor) | Boxes = Ceiling(Gross Sq Ft รท Box Coverage)
In Plain English: To calculate flooring materials, multiply room length by width to get base square footage, add any closets or hallways, multiply by 1.10 (to add 10% for cuts and waste), and divide by square feet per carton. Always round up to the next full box because retailers do not sell partial cartons.
Mathematical Variables & Inputs:
  • Length & Width: Physical wall-to-wall measurements in linear feet (12 inches = 1.0 ft)
  • Net Area: Raw floor surface area = Length ร— Width
  • Waste Factor: 10% standard straight plank; 15% for 45-degree diagonal installations; 20% for herringbone or multi-sized stone patterns
  • Box Coverage: Manufacturer carton yield (typically 18 to 24 sq ft per box for plank flooring)
  • Labor Rate: Contractor installation charge per gross square foot

๐Ÿ“ Step-by-Step Practical Flooring Calculation Example

Follow this real-world home renovation example for a living room and coat closet:

  1. Measure Living Room: Length = 22 feet, Width = 16 feet. Net Area = 22 ร— 16 = 352 sq ft.
  2. Add Coat Closet: 4 ft ร— 5 ft = 20 sq ft. Total Net Area = 352 + 20 = 372 sq ft.
  3. Factor in 10% Waste: 372 sq ft ร— 1.10 = 409.2 sq ft needed.
  4. Calculate Boxes Needed: Selected Luxury Vinyl Plank (LVP) covers 21.5 sq ft per box. 409.2 รท 21.5 = 19.03 $ ightarrow$ Order 20 full boxes (430 sq ft total).
  5. Calculate Material Expense: 430 sq ft ร— $3.89/sq ft = $1,672.70.
  6. Add Installation Labor: Professional installer charges $2.25/sq ft. 409.2 sq ft ร— $2.25 = $920.70.
  7. Total Project Cost: $1,672.70 (materials) + $920.70 (labor) = $2,593.40 total project investment ($6.97/sq ft finished).
๐Ÿ’ก Pro Tip for Solving Complex Cases: Always keep one full, unopened box of flooring stored in a climate-controlled closet after the project is complete. Flooring dye lots change and styles are discontinued frequently by manufacturers. Having an original spare box ensures you can seamlessly replace damaged planks if a plumbing leak or heavy appliance scratch occurs years later.
๐Ÿ›๏ธ US Regulatory & Industry Benchmark: The Tile Council of North America (TCNA Handbook) and the National Wood Flooring Association (NWFA) establish US installation tolerances. Standard subfloor deflection must not exceed L/360 for ceramic tile and L/720 for natural stone to prevent grout cracking. Solid hardwood flooring must acclimate inside the home's ambient climate (35%โ€“55% relative humidity) for a minimum of 72 hours prior to nailing.

Flooring selection is one of the highest-ROI home improvement projects in the United States, typically returning 70% to 80% of its cost upon home resale according to the National Association of Realtors (NAR). In recent years, Luxury Vinyl Plank (LVP) with a rigid stone-polymer composite (SPC) core has captured the largest market share due to its 100% waterproof performance, realistic wood-grain embossing, and straightforward click-lock floating installation.

Homeowners must also evaluate transition mouldings and underlayment requirements. While many modern LVP planks feature pre-attached acoustic foam pads, concrete subfloors in basements or ground-floor slabs require a 6-mil polyethylene vapor barrier to block rising hydrostatic moisture. In addition, measure doorways to calculate T-mouldings, reducers, and quarter-round shoe moulding linear footage.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between nominal and actual tile square footage?

Tile dimensions listed on boxes are often 'nominal' (e.g., a 12x24 inch tile may actually measure 11.75x23.75 inches to accommodate a standard 1/8-inch or 1/16-inch grout joint). The square footage listed on the manufacturer box already accounts for standard grout spacing, so use the carton coverage metric directly.

Can I install new flooring directly over existing tile or vinyl?

Yes, floating floors like Luxury Vinyl Plank and laminate can be installed over existing firmly bonded tile, sheet vinyl, or hardwood, provided the surface is clean, flat within 3/16-inch over a 10-foot span, and deep grout lines are leveled with an embossing leveler compound.
